Where is Block 674A Jurong West St 65?
Block 674A Jurong West St 65 is an HDB block in Jurong West.
Block 674A Jurong West St 65 is an HDB block located along Jurong West St 65. The block is recorded as completed around 2000, with up to 16 storeys. It has an estimated 105 residential units based on the HDB property information dataset. Flat types in the block include 4-room and 5-room units.
The address is Block 674A Jurong West St 65, Singapore 641674. It is part of District 22, Jurong, the Jurong West planning area. The block falls within the West Region and the OCR market segment.
The nearest rail connection is Boon Lay MRT, approximately 773m away, around 12 minutes on foot. Nearby amenities include Jurong Point for shopping, SHENG SIONG SUPERMARKET PTE LTD for groceries, Jurong West Hawker Centre for food options, Westwood Park Playground for greenery and recreation, Pioneer Polyclinic for polyclinic services, and The Frontier Community Club for community facilities.

What does it cost to buy a flat at Block 674A Jurong West St 65?
Buying a flat at Block 674A Jurong West St 65 (~S$530k) needs about S$4,225/mo in income and S$1,990/mo in repayments, after S$10,500 stamp duty and a S$133k downpayment.
Illustrative, for a buyer at the recent median resale price (S$530k) — 25% downpayment (bank-loan basis), 25-year loan at 3.5% p.a. Rates as of May 2026. Run it for your own profile →

First-time HDB buyers pay no Additional Buyer’s Stamp Duty (ABSD) and may qualify for CPF Housing Grants of up to S$80,000+, which lower the cash required — these are not included above. An HDB concessionary loan also allows a smaller downpayment.
